Different Types of Street Defects

Street defects and other dangerous roadway conditions for New York City bicyclists include:

  • Pot holes
  • Construction plates
  • Road trenches and other temporary paving issues
  • Debris from construction sites
  • Negligently placed equipment in bike lanes and other sections of the road
  • Uneven pavement
  • Hummocks and ponding

Responsibility for Bicycle Accidents Resulting From Street Defects

Bicycle accidents resulting from defective roadways are often complex. In order to determine who is liable for the accident and your injuries, your New York City attorney must first identify the owner of the road.

The majority of roads in New York City are owned by the State. Special rules apply to different types of roads and streets. In order to successfully file a claim, you must prove that the City or Municipality had “prior written notice of the defect” prior to the onset of your accident. You may also be able to win your lawsuit if you can prove that the City or Municipality affirmatively created the condition, worked in the area where your accident occurred, or there was some type of prior notice of the defective condition.

You may also file a personal injury lawsuit against any contractor who worked on the defective road where your bicycle injury happened. You or your New York City bicycle attorney can obtain necessary information concerning a road from the government by making a demand pursuant to the Freedom of Information Law.
